Webb15 maj 2024 · 2: Use Cardboard Collar To Protect Your Plants. To protect larger plants from slugs and snails that won’t fit under a cloche, use a cardboard collar instead. Simply take a piece of cardboard about 6-8 inches high, bend it into a circle or square that fits around the base of your plant, and attach the edges. Slugs love to feed on the leaves of plants as well as ripening fruits and veggies and decaying plants on the ground. In particular, they love seedlings and leafy vegetables. Especially susceptible plants include lettuce, cabbage, basil, strawberries, hostas, daylilies, delphiniums, and dahlias.They stick to the shadows …
WebbTomatoes (Solanum lycopersicum) are occasionally eaten by snails, primarily slugs. Young plants are particularly affected and fruits are also partially hollowed out by them. Creeping or bushy plants on the ground are more at risk because they are in close proximity to the snails. Larger, healthy plants are often avoided.
